Indonesia replaces finance minister after violent protests

Indonesian President Prabowo Subianto on Monday removed Finance Minister Sri Mulyani Indrawati in a cabinet reshuffle following deadly anti-government protests across the country. Sri Mulyani is an influential figure who once served as managing director of the World Bank and was finance minister under three different presidents. PR promises better facilities on Pindi-Lahore route

Pakistan Railways has taken notice of complaints regarding inadequate travel facilities, poor punctuality, and lack of amenities on railcars operating twice daily between Rawalpindi and Lahore. Following reports published in Daily Express and The Express Tribune, the department has decided to induct four newly furnished coaches equipped with modern facilities into the system starting October. Kazakh DPM Murat Nurtleu arrives in Pakistan on two-day visit

Kazakhstan’s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Murat Nurtleu arrived in Islamabad on a two-day official visit to Pakistan on Monday, Radio Pakistan reported. He was received at the airport by Additional Secretary (West Asia) at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, Syed Ali Asad Gillani, along with other senior officials.
